Step by Step to to Start a GE Dishwasher. 1. Open the dishwasher door and load the dishracks and cutlery basket. To kick things off, we need to load the dishwasher with dirty dishes and ... 2. Add detergent to the detergent compartment. 3. Add rinse aid to the rinse aid dispenser (optional) 4. Shut ... You will see an illuminated Start/Reset button on your model … WebSep 14, 2024 · Select the new cycle or option, then press start/reset again. This should make the start/reset light glow. Now check the detergent dispensers to ensure they're full for the new cycle, and then close the door and the machine should begin.
